Handover, on-call: Mossgate digest scheduler. Batch emails fire at 06:00 UTC; if the queue stalls, restart the fanout worker, not the scheduler. Duplicate sends were fixed Tuesday — don't re-run yesterday's batch. Dashboards under "digest-health." Escalate to Rhea only if backlog exceeds two hours. The scheduler admin vault opens with the recovery passphrase below.

recovery phrase for bawep-kawef: oliath-casdor

## Deep-link routing — Bramblehop SDK

Plugin authors: register link patterns in the manifest before runtime. Unregistered paths fall through to the Bramblehop home screen; no error surfaces to the user. If your links misroute, verify the manifest pattern order — first match wins, wildcards last. Routing tables rebuild on app launch, not hot-reload. When filing a routing issue, include the SDK build token, shown below.

build token for yagug-kafog: htk31_e462130c366caae6ce4c8057e0f2196

Subject: GridWeaver cut-over — done

Hi Priya,

Quick wrap-up: we moved the crossword generator off the old monolith onto the GridWeaver service last night. Puzzle generation latency dropped noticeably, and the nightly batch of themed grids completed without a single dead-end fill. One hiccup with the clue-difficulty scorer was patched mid-window. Old endpoints stay in read-only mode for two weeks, then we tear them down. For reference, the service is now running with these configuration values.

service settings:
PRAIX_LOG_LEVEL=error
PRAIX_METRICS_HOST=metrics.praix.qorvelcorp.corp
PRAIX_POOL_SIZE=16

## Service accounts — Largediff

The Largediff viewer renders side-by-side diffs for files up to 4 GB by streaming chunks from the Coldshelf blob store. It runs under a single service account, svc-largediff, which holds read-only access to Coldshelf and write access to its own render cache. The account cannot list buckets outside its namespace, and all calls are logged to the Ledgerline audit pipeline for 180 days. For review purposes, the account authenticates to the internal Coldshelf gateway using the key below.

gateway credential: kto3_qfe